A high-scoring second day at IPL 2019 pushed Parthiv Patel, top-scorer in the opening match, out of the top ten in the list of highest run-scorers. David Warner celebrated his return to cricket with a 53-ball 85 against Kolkata Knight Riders. Nobody has scored more than him till now.

Nitish Rana (68 in 47) came close, and while Andre Russell (49* in 19) sealed the match in KKR’s favour, there were not enough runs to be made for him to usurp Warner. And in the second match, Rishabh Pant (78* in 27) came even closer, while Yuvraj Singh got 53 off 35 balls.

With 3 wickets, Mitchell McClenaghan joined Imran Tahir and Harbhajan Singh at the top of the table. Kagiso Rabada, Ishant Sharma, and Russell also picked up 2 wickets apiece.
